Ingredients
For the Crust
- 1 pre-made graham cracker crust (or homemade – see variations below)
For the Cheesecake Filling
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 ½ cups whipped topping (Cool Whip or homemade)
- Assorted food coloring (pastel colors like pink, blue, yellow, and purple)
For Garnishing (Optional but recommended!)
- Extra whipped cream
- Festive sprinkles
- White chocolate shavings or edible glitter
Instructions
Step 1: Make the Cheesecake Filling
- In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ese until smooth and creamy.
- Add powdered sugar and vanilla extract, then mix until well combined.
- Gently fold in the whipped topping using a spatula until the mixture is light and fluffy. Be careful not to overmix, as you want to maintain an airy texture.
Step 2: Create the Swirl Effect
- Divide the cheesecake mixture evenly into four small bowls.
- Add a few drops of food coloring to each bowl and mix gently until the colors are well blended. Use pastel shades like pink, blue, yellow, and purple for a festive look.
- Spoon the different colored mixtures randomly onto the graham cracker crust, creating small dollops of each color.
- Take a toothpick or skewer and gently swirl the colors together to create a marbled effect. Avoid over-mixing, as you want distinct color streaks.
Step 3: Chill & Serve
- Place the pie in the refrigerator and let it set for at least 4 hours, or ideally overnight, to achieve a firm and creamy texture.
- Before serving, top with whipped cream, festive sprinkles, or white chocolate shavings for extra decoration.
- Slice, serve, and enjoy the sweet, creamy, and colorful goodness!
Formation & Science Behind the Perfect No-Bake Cheesecake
- Cream Cheese Base: The high-fat content in cream cheese provides structure, while powdered sugar adds sweetness and smoothness.
- Whipped Topping: Lightens the mixture and creates an airy texture without the need for baking.
- Chilling Process: Unlike traditional cheesecakes that rely on eggs and baking, this no-bake version sets in the fridge, allowing the fats and stabilizers in the ingredients to firm up naturally.
- Swirling Technique: The marble effect works best when colors are dropped randomly and swirled gently to maintain a vibrant pattern without blending into one solid shade.
Tips & Variations
Crust Options
- Oreo Crust: Use crushed chocolate cookies mixed with melted butter for a richer flavor.
- Sugar Cookie Crust: Press sugar cookie dough into the pan and bake for a crispy, sweet alternative.
- Gluten-Free Option: Use gluten-free graham crackers or almond flour mixed with melted butter for a delicious gluten-free version.
Extra Flavor Boost
- Citrus Zest: Add lemon or orange zest to the cheesecake mixture for a refreshing, tangy contrast.
- Coconut Extract: A few drops of coconut extract can add a tropical twist to the pie.
- Berry Swirl: Mix in a tablespoon of raspberry or blueberry puree for an added fruity layer.
Make It Healthier
- Low-Sugar Version: Use sugar-free whipped topping and a powdered sugar substitute.
- Greek Yogurt Addition: Substitute part of the cream cheese with Greek yogurt for added protein and a slightly tangy flavor.
